navicat我覺(jué)得做程序的基本上都會(huì)用,它方便,快捷,直觀等,優(yōu)點(diǎn)很多,這也是我寫(xiě)這篇文章的原因。以前我基本上都是用phpmyadmin,也挺好用,不過(guò)也有不少缺點(diǎn),比如數(shù)據(jù)庫(kù)備份文件太大,根本沒(méi)法用導(dǎo)入,多數(shù)據(jù)庫(kù)服務(wù)器管理,還要去配置phpmyadmin,其實(shí)挺不爽的。navicat對(duì)于剛用的人來(lái)說(shuō),其實(shí)也不是很方便,但是用熟就不一樣了。下面就如何結(jié)合快捷鍵的方式,讓navicat用著更舒服。 一,navicat如何寫(xiě)sql語(yǔ)句查詢? 方法1:ctrl+q就會(huì)彈出一個(gè)sql輸入窗口,就可以在里面寫(xiě)sql了。寫(xiě)完sql后,直接ctrl+r就執(zhí)行sql了。還有一點(diǎn),寫(xiě)sql語(yǔ)句時(shí),navicat會(huì)提示的,根代碼補(bǔ)全差不多,挺爽的。 方法2:按f6會(huì)彈出一個(gè)命令窗口,就根mysql -u mysql -p進(jìn)去時(shí)操作一樣,不過(guò)\G用的時(shí)候會(huì)報(bào)錯(cuò)。在這里也可以查詢。 小技巧:這些窗口,可以拖動(dòng)到一起的,看下圖片 上圖中有二個(gè)窗口,我們可以通過(guò),快捷鍵ctrl+tab,在窗口間進(jìn)行切換。 二,navicat如何備份,還原數(shù)據(jù)庫(kù),以及表? 方法1:右擊數(shù)據(jù)名=》選中dump sql file就可以備份,如果要還原,就選execute sql file就行了。備份表,根備份數(shù)據(jù)庫(kù)一樣操作。還原表,就用import wizard就行了。這種備份導(dǎo)出來(lái)的只能是.sql文件。如果想備份成其他文件格式,看方法 2. 方法2:點(diǎn)擊數(shù)據(jù)庫(kù),在點(diǎn)上方的export wizard就會(huì)彈出一個(gè)窗口,讓你選擇備份成什么樣的文件,下一步 如果表太多,用這種方法備份,實(shí)在是不方便。如果是導(dǎo)入的話就用import wizard就行了。備份表同樣的操作。 三,如何查看表數(shù)據(jù)和表結(jié)構(gòu)? 雙擊表就可以查看表數(shù)據(jù)了,ctrl+d不光可以看到表結(jié)構(gòu),還可以看到索引,外鍵,觸發(fā)器等。 四,如何管理多個(gè)mysql服務(wù)器? 點(diǎn)擊左上方的connection按鈕,多連接幾個(gè)就行了。 五,如何用navicat對(duì)數(shù)據(jù)庫(kù)管理員進(jìn)行管理? 點(diǎn)擊左上方manage users就會(huì)彈出一個(gè)窗口,里面會(huì)列出所有的mysql管理員。修改權(quán)限后,保存就行了。 上面5點(diǎn),只是一些常用的,基本的操作,navicat還有很多人性化的操作。在這里就不多說(shuō)了,有興趣的朋友,可以下一個(gè)來(lái)玩玩。個(gè)人覺(jué)得用著挺爽的。 |
|
來(lái)自: 隨波_逐流 > 《數(shù)據(jù)庫(kù)》